The Fourth of July, America's Independence Day, is a beloved national holiday commemorating the adoption of the Declaration of Independence in 1776. This day is synonymous with patriotism, summer fun, and a plethora of traditions that bring families and communities together. Here are some of the best ways to celebrate this iconic holiday.
1. Fireworks Displays
Nothing says Fourth of July like a spectacular fireworks show. Cities and towns across the United States host large fireworks displays that light up the night sky with vibrant colors and stunning patterns. Whether you're attending a professional show or setting off sparklers in your backyard, fireworks are a must. Remember to prioritize safety and check local regulations if you plan to handle fireworks yourself.
2. Backyard Barbecues
Grilling is a staple of Fourth of July celebrations. Gather your friends and family for a classic barbecue featuring hamburgers, hot dogs, ribs, and corn on the cob. Don't forget the sides—potato salad, coleslaw, and baked beans are perennial favorites. For dessert, patriotic-themed treats like red, white, and blue cupcakes or a flag cake can add a festive touch.
3. Parades
Many communities hold parades on the morning of the Fourth.** These parades often feature floats, marching bands, local organizations, and a display of patriotic colors. Attending a parade is a great way to kick off the day, show your community spirit, and honor the country’s history and those who have served.
4. Lake or Pool Day
Taking advantage of the summer weather by spending the day near water is a popular tradition. Head to the lake or a local pool. Enjoy activities like swimming, paddleboarding, boating, or simply lounging with a good book. Don't forget to pack a picnic full of Fourth of July favorites to keep you fueled throughout the day.
5. Historical Tours and Reenactments
Independence Day is an excellent time to explore America's history.** Visit historical sites, museums, or attend a Revolutionary War reenactment to gain a deeper understanding of the nation's origins. Many historical sites offer special programs or tours on the Fourth of July, providing a fun and educational experience for all ages.
6. Outdoor Games and Activities
Incorporate some fun and games into your celebration.** Organize a friendly game of softball, volleyball, or frisbee. Classic lawn games like cornhole, horseshoes, and bocce ball are also great options. These activities are perfect for engaging guests of all ages and fostering a festive atmosphere.
7. Concerts and Live Music
Enjoying live music is another fantastic way to celebrate.** Many cities host concerts featuring patriotic music, local bands, or even big-name artists. Whether you're attending a formal concert or a casual outdoor performance, music can enhance the celebratory mood.
8. Decorating Your Home
Show your patriotic spirit by decorating your home in red, white, and blue.** Hang flags, banners, and streamers, and consider adding themed tablecloths, napkins, and centerpieces for your barbecue. This not only enhances the festive atmosphere but also shows your pride in the nation.
9. Watching a Patriotic Movie
For a more relaxed celebration, consider a patriotic movie marathon. Films like "Independence Day," "National Treasure," and "1776" can provide entertainment while celebrating the holiday's themes. Gather some popcorn, and settle in for a cozy evening.
10. Attending a Sports Event
Baseball is often called America's pastime, and many people enjoy attending a game on the Fourth of July. Whether it’s a major league game or a local league, the experience is heightened by the holiday spirit. Many ballparks also offer post-game fireworks, making for a perfect ending to the day.
The Fourth of July offers a unique blend of tradition, fun, and patriotism. Whether you're enjoying fireworks, grilling with friends, participating in a parade, or simply soaking up the summer sun, there are countless ways to celebrate this special day. Embrace the festivities, cherish the time with loved ones, and honor the freedoms and history that make America unique. Happy Independence Day!
